Colorado State University Pueblo vs University of Colorado Colorado Springs

Colorado State University Pueblo University of Colorado Colorado Springs
Acceptance rate lower = more selective 95% 97%
SAT range (mid 50%) n/a 1,010-1,220
ACT range (mid 50%) 19-26 20-26
Average net price what students actually pay after aid $10,051 $15,788
Sticker cost of attendance $23,937 $24,595
Graduation rate 40% 47%
Retention rate 64% 68%
Undergraduates 3,042 8,697
Student-faculty ratio 16:1 15:1
Setting Pueblo, CO Colorado Springs, CO
Type Public Public
Application fee $25 $50
Test policy Required for some Test-optional

Which is cheaper, Colorado State University Pueblo or University of Colorado Colorado Springs?

Colorado State University Pueblo has the lower average net price ($10,051 versus $15,788). Net price is what families actually pay after grants and scholarships, so it is a truer comparison than sticker price. Run each school's net price calculator for your own income.
